TSTEP — 과도해석의 적분·출력 시간 스텝 정의
TSTEP 은 transient analysis 에서 해가 생성·출력되는 time step 간격을 정의하는 Bulk Data entry 이며, 동시에 이를 선택하는 동명의 Case Control 명령(TSTEP=n)이 존재한다 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.2972] [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673].
정의·용도
TSTEP (Bulk Data) 는 transient analysis 에서 해가 생성·출력될 time step intervals 를 정의한다 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.2972]. TSTEP (Case Control) 은 linear 또는 nonlinear transient analysis 의 적분(integration) 및 출력 time step 을 선택한다 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673].
선택 규칙은 솔루션 시퀀스에 따라 다음과 같다 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673]:
- linear transient analysis(SOL 109, SOL 112) 와 nonlinear transient analysis(SOL 129, SOL 159) 를 실행하려면 TSTEP entry 가 반드시 선택되어야 한다.
- nonlinear transient 문제에서는 각 subcase 마다 entry 가 선택되어야 한다.
- modal frequency response analysis(SOL 111, SOL 146)에서 time-dependent load 를 적용할 때는 TSTEP 명령으로 TSTEP entry 를 선택해야 하며, 이때 time-dependent load 는 Fourier transform 을 통해 frequency domain 에서 재계산된다.
- SOL 400 의 한 subcase 또는 STEP 에서는 TSTEP, TSTEPNL, NLSTEP 중 하나만 지정해야 하며, NLSTEP 이 지정되면 TSTEP 명령은 무시된다.
주의할 점은, TSTEP Case Control entry 로 TSTEPNL Bulk Data entry 를 선택할 수 있으나, Bulk Data TSTEP 과 Bulk Data TSTEPNL 은 완전히 다른 entry 라는 것이다 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.674].
형식 / 필드 / 구문
Case Control 형식은 TSTEP=n 이며, n 은 Bulk Data 의 TSTEP set identification number 이다(Integer > 0) [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673].
Bulk Data 형식은 다음과 같다 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.2972]:
| 1 | 2 | 3 | 4 | 5 | 6 |
|---|---|---|---|---|---|
| TSTEP | SID | N1 | DT1 | NO1 | |
| N2 | DT2 | NO2 | |||
| -etc.- |
| Describer | 의미 |
|---|---|
| SID | Set identification number (Integer > 0) |
| Ni | 값 DTi 의 time step 수 (Integer > 1) |
| DTi | Time increment (Real > 0.0) |
| NOi | 출력 skip factor. 매 NOi 번째 step 만 출력에 저장 (Integer > 0; Default = 1) |
사용 예
Case Control [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673]:
TSTEP=731
Bulk Data [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.2972]:
TSTEP 2 10 .001 5
9 0.01 1
관련 항목
- TSTEPNL — nonlinear transient analysis 용 Transient Time Step Set Selection [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.674]
- NLSTEP — SOL 400 의 대안 time step 제어 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673]
- SOL 109 Direct Transient Response
- SOL 112 Modal Transient Response
- SOL 129 Nonlinear Transient Response
- SOL 400
- DLOAD · TLOAD1 · TLOAD2 — transient load 정의 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.398]
- FEMCHECK — TSTEP 참조 유효성 검사 항목에 포함 [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.398]
- Case Control · Bulk Data
- Quick Reference Guide · DMAP Programmer’s Guide
출처
- [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.673] — TSTEP (Case) Format·Example·Remarks
- [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.674] — TSTEPNL (Case) 대비
- [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.2972] — TSTEP Bulk Data Format·정의
- [MSC_Nastran_2022.4_Quick_Reference_Guide.pdf p.398] — FEMCHECK 의 TSTEP 검사